Holi colors, especially non-organic ones, may contain chemicals that strip your skin of natural oils. This often leads to dryness, breakouts, redness, or irritation. Hair can become rough, frizzy, and difficult to manage.
Proper pre-Holi skincare focuses on hydration and strengthening the skin barrier. When your skin is well-moisturized and nourished, it is less likely to absorb harsh pigments. Similarly, healthy hair coated with protective treatments is more resistant to damage.

One of the most recommended pre-Holi spa treatments is a body polishing treatment. This therapy exfoliates dead skin cells using natural scrubs and nourishing ingredients.
Exfoliation before Holi helps in two important ways. First, it removes existing buildup and dullness, giving your skin a healthy glow. Second, when you exfoliate and then deeply moisturize, your skin absorbs hydration more effectively.
Well-polished and moisturized skin makes it easier to wash off colors later, reducing the need for harsh scrubbing that can cause irritation.
Hydration is the key to effective skin care before Holi. Dry skin tends to absorb color more deeply, making removal difficult. Hydrating spa therapies focus on restoring moisture and strengthening the outermost layer of the skin.
Oil-based massages are particularly beneficial before Holi. Natural oils nourish the skin and create a subtle protective coating. This coating acts as a shield against harsh pigments and sun exposure.
Deep conditioning body wraps and moisturizing facials also help boost hydration levels. These treatments leave your skin supple, resilient, and ready for celebration.
While most people focus on skincare, hair care before Holi is equally important. Colors can make hair brittle and dry, especially when combined with sun exposure and repeated washing.
Pre-Holi hair spa treatments deeply condition and strengthen your strands. Nourishing masks and oil therapies create a protective layer that reduces color absorption and prevents excessive dryness.
Healthy, conditioned hair not only withstands color better but also feels softer and easier to manage after washing.
Along with booking a Holi skin protection spa treatment, a few simple steps can help during the celebration itself. Apply a generous amount of oil or moisturizer before stepping out. Wear protective clothing like full sleeves when possible. Stay hydrated and avoid excessive sun exposure.
Post-Holi, cleanse gently using mild products and avoid aggressive scrubbing. If your skin feels dry or irritated, consider a soothing spa therapy afterward to restore balance.
